求和、计数、排序等功能强大的sumproduct函数

2022-10-25 12:39:32 浏览数 (2)

求和、计数、排序等功能非常的强大sumproduct函数

SUMPRODUCT函数不仅能求和、还能计数、排序,其功能非常的强大

【知识点】

一、语法结构。

SUMPRODUCT(array1,array2,array3……)。

其主要作用是返回给定数组对应的乘积之和。

SUMPRODUCT中SUM是求和的意思,PRODUCT是相乘的意思,总意思就是相乘之后再求和。

【用法实例】

◆实例1,求:总价=数量*单价

◆实例2单个条件计数

=SUMPRODUCT((F3:F13=

或=SUMPRODUCT(N(F3:F13=F17))

◆实例3多条件计数

‘语文优秀=SUMPRODUCT((F3:F13=L4)*(H3:H13>=80))

三科都是优秀

=SUMPRODUCT((F3:F13=L4)*(H3:H13>=80)*(I3:I13>=80)*(J3:J13>=80))

◆实例4 SUMPRODUCT实现中国式排名(并列名次连续排名)

1 SUMPRODUCT与COUNTIF结合进行排名

=SUMPRODUCT((K3:K13>K3)/COUNTIF(K3:K13,K3:K

2 Rank排名’=RANK(K3,K3:K13)

大家注意其中的区别

◆实例5单条件求和

=SUMPRODUCT((B3:B13=G3)*E3:E

◆实例6多条件求和

行政’=SUMPRODUCT((B3:B13=G12)*(D3:D13=H11)*E3:E13)

职工‘=SUMPRODUCT((B3:B13=G12)*(D3:D13=I11)*E3:E13)

也可以这样写:

=SUMPRODUCT((B3:B13=G12)*(D3:D13=H11),3:E

注意“*”或”,”

多条件求和的通用写法是:

=SUMPRODUCT((条件一)*(条件二)*……*(条件N),求和范围)

多条件的求和可也以用SUMIFS

语法

SUMIFS(sum_range,criteria_range1, criteria1, [criteria_range2, criteria2], ...)

‘=SUMIFS(E3:E13,B3:B13,G12,D3:D13,H

◆实例7 SUMPRODUCT与FIND结合进行模糊求个数

◆实例8 SUMPRODUCT与COUNTIF不重复计数

◆实例9跨列求和

计划 =SUMPRODUCT((D3:I3=J3)*D4:

实际=SUMPRODUCT((D3:I3=K3)*D4:

◆实例10 多条件区域汇总求和

计划=SUMPRODUCT((B4:B14=C20)*(D3:I3=D19)*D4:I14)

实际=SUMPRODUCT((B4:B14=C20)*(D3:I3=E19)*D4:I14)

0 人点赞